

251. The Joy of Slow with Leslie Martino
Aug 21, 2024
Leslie Martino, an experienced homeschooling mom with degrees from Columbia University, shares her wisdom on embracing slow learning. She advocates for prioritizing depth over speed in education, emphasizing meaningful learning experiences. The discussion highlights the importance of reflection, creating space for joy, and nurturing curiosity without rigid schedules. Listeners will appreciate her insights on balancing family agendas and fostering enriching connections with their children, making learning a delightful journey rather than a race.
